Renewable energy engineering degree programs focus on the study of sustainable energy sources and technologies to address environmental challenges and promote clean energy solutions.
Key Features
- Curriculum covers wind, solar, hydroelectric, geothermal, and biomass energy systems
- In-depth study of renewable energy technologies and their applications
- Hands-on experience with renewable energy systems through labs and projects
- Integration of engineering principles with environmental sustainability concepts
